Output 30615aa3d54a58769257c4715faded904cf10841c66c7f2336b810354ae585a5:0

value
12453390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b17793e25bf0704d94ff74731e57e2d78960906 OP_EQUAL
address
39zfXyW1o1wF9gHc2EpVEcyMskcQYkNQiq
transaction
30615aa3d54a58769257c4715faded904cf10841c66c7f2336b810354ae585a5
spent
true